Output 5ca6622901179bdba243a637a3741af5f1015ec6b937a768a3947ec170e666c8:47

value
41488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e1f36c126a9da3208434cde97db72b73f2d965 OP_EQUAL
address
3QNzBTb54Q3xyZuCX45cT1sAn9KdBhry7w
transaction
5ca6622901179bdba243a637a3741af5f1015ec6b937a768a3947ec170e666c8